Tigers vs UCF By The Numbers 2021
The easy way to do this is to put up a link saying see previous years.

Both teams will once again attempt to outscore the other and hope to find a way to get a stop.

Tigers need some breaks in this one to stay close enough to pull out the win.

Tigers have a big advantage in the punt and punt return part of the game.

Surprising that a team that is so strong in kick-off defense could be as weak in punt return defense as UCF.

Keene has only 4 TDs to go with his 4 ints and has 8 rushed for 11 yards.

The running game is by committee with no active player with 300 yards rushing this year.

Tigers must do something they have not done very well this year.

Get pressure on QB and not let them sit back and wait for WR to come open.

When he has time his completion % is right at 62%.

But is not that mobile as his longest run for the year is 3 yards.

There are two main receiving targets O'Keefe(63 ypg) and Johnson(48 ypg).

While top two runners are Richardson (59.4 ypg) and Coles (39 ypg).

Wildcard will be team focus as Coach Malzahn left the team as soon as the game was over to be with his daughter who suffered complications during childbirth.

This could either rally the team behind the coach or it could negatively affect the team and cause them to lose focus.

Tigers will be missing their big RB, Clark, and two of their DBs in Rogers and Pickens as all three are listed as questionable.

Seth did leave the Navy game due to being banged up with an arm injury was is expected to play.

If Seth plays under control and doesn't let what should be a rowdy crowd get to him the Tigers could come away with the win.

TURNOVERS as usual can be determining factor this week.
